Scenario of use:



This storyboard of the scenario of use displays how two friends begin their night with the wrist bands and due to excessive drinking one results needing to go home. It shows that the friends don't need to be together to use the Drunk Watch.

  1. Combining two types of input: sweat (how drunk?), and push of a button (how much fun?) could allow for a variety of meaningful awareness messages. Two aspects need further exploration: the use of a 'screen' (not allowed in the project scope), and the push button. Using lights or colours to communicate level of drunkness from a wearable device does not necesarily requires a GUI. Perhaps making the wearable device to turn (or lit) with different colours would be one way to go. Communicating our level of enjoyment could use gestures that are relevant to the social context of the activity. And, is the aesthetics of the proposal meaningful for the intended user group?
